Bitcoin Price Drop Triggers $12 Billion in Potential Liquidations

According to data from Coinglass, if Bitcoin (BTC) were to drop below $60,468, main CEX exchange cumulative long contracts would trigger a collective liquidation strength of $1.242 billion.

This estimate is based on current market conditions and may change as the price fluctuates.

Conversely, if BTC were to surge past $66,452, main CEX exchange cumulative short contracts would result in a collective liquidation strength of $1.122 billion.
